Transaction 99c6950299e90dd5c7dee30e7de6614f4a51caa0a0bb0c784a478d6b67d920b7
1 Input
1 Output
-
99c6950299e90dd5c7dee30e7de6614f4a51caa0a0bb0c784a478d6b67d920b7:0
- value
- 50684
- script pubkey
- OP_0 OP_PUSHBYTES_20 59d15a19b8561b8940bff23ed058f6e4994d9b64
- address
- bc1qt8g45xdc2cdcjs9l7gldqk8kujv5mxmy45wl09